WebBasement moisture sources. Rain and groundwater. In a 1-inch rain, 1,250 gallons of water fall on the roof of a 2,000-square-foot house. Without proper grading, gutters and ... Web2. Plug Gaps. If you see water dribbling into the basement through cracks or gaps around plumbing pipes, you can plug the openings yourself with hydraulic cement or polyurethane caulk for about $10. Plugs work when the problem is simply a hole that water oozes through, either from surface runoff or from wet soil. WebSlope the ground away from your foundation. Make sure that the ground next to your foundation slopes away from the foundation to divert rainwater away from your home. The “crown” of dirt around your house should slope at least six inches over the first 10 feet in all directions. 4. Seal gaps in the basement. how to change column names

WebIn one bucket, drill several small holes into the side and bottom of that bucket. Nest the drilled bucket into the other bucket. Fill the bucket up with rock salt. Collected water will drip through the holes in the inner bucket into in the outer bucket over time. Empty the outer bucket as necessary. WebFeb 23, 2024 · Drain the water out of the crawl space. WebNov 26, 2024 · To remove water from your basement: 1. Locate the source of the water and stop it if possible. This could be due to heavy rains, a failed sump pump, or a leaky pipe. Once you have stopped the source of water, you can begin removing it from your basement. 2. Place a submersible pump in the deepest part of the water. Interior waterproofing, which may include installing a French interior drain, could cost more ... michael doherty bhhsneWebFEMA goes on to recommend pumping out the basement one foot of water at a time, with a waiting period of 24 hours in between. If the water level stabilizes or continues to drop, you can increase the pumping rate. If you can see any foundation damage caused by the flood, stop pumping. Run a Dehumidifier to Reduce Moisture in the Air. Once the sources of moisture are controlled, the easiest way to reduce moisture in the air is with a dehumidifier. A dehumidifier can pull gallons of moisture from the air each day. michael doherty bio energyWebHow to use DampRid. Remove lid and cut open the bags of crystals.
